ConfigureOptionsSpeechToTextClient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Stellt einen delegierenden Chatclient dar, der eine SpeechToTextOptions Instanz konfiguriert, die vom Rest der Pipeline verwendet wird.
public ref class ConfigureOptionsSpeechToTextClient sealed : Microsoft::Extensions::AI::DelegatingSpeechToTextClient
[System.Diagnostics.CodeAnalysis.Experimental("MEAI001", UrlFormat="https://aka.ms/dotnet-extensions-warnings/{0}")]
public sealed class ConfigureOptionsSpeechToTextClient : Microsoft.Extensions.AI.DelegatingSpeechToTextClient
public sealed class ConfigureOptionsSpeechToTextClient : Microsoft.Extensions.AI.DelegatingSpeechToTextClient
[<System.Diagnostics.CodeAnalysis.Experimental("MEAI001", UrlFormat="https://aka.ms/dotnet-extensions-warnings/{0}")>]
type ConfigureOptionsSpeechToTextClient = class
inherit DelegatingSpeechToTextClient
type ConfigureOptionsSpeechToTextClient = class
inherit DelegatingSpeechToTextClient
Public NotInheritable Class ConfigureOptionsSpeechToTextClient
Inherits DelegatingSpeechToTextClient
- Vererbung
- Attribute
Konstruktoren
| Name | Beschreibung |
|---|---|
| ConfigureOptionsSpeechToTextClient(ISpeechToTextClient, Action<SpeechToTextOptions>) |
Initialisiert eine neue Instanz der ConfigureOptionsSpeechToTextClient Klasse mit dem angegebenen |
Eigenschaften
| Name | Beschreibung |
|---|---|
| InnerClient |
Ruft das innere ISpeechToTextClientab. (Geerbt von DelegatingSpeechToTextClient) |
Methoden
| Name | Beschreibung |
|---|---|
| Dispose() |
Führt anwendungsdefinierte Aufgaben aus, die mit dem Freigeben, Freigeben oder Zurücksetzen nicht verwalteter Ressourcen verknüpft sind. (Geerbt von DelegatingSpeechToTextClient) |
| Dispose(Boolean) |
Stellt einen Mechanismus zum Freigeben nicht verwalteter Ressourcen bereit. (Geerbt von DelegatingSpeechToTextClient) |
| GetService(Type, Object) |
Fragt nach ISpeechToTextClient einem Objekt des angegebenen Typs |
| GetStreamingTextAsync(Stream, SpeechToTextOptions, CancellationToken) |
Stellt einen delegierenden Chatclient dar, der eine SpeechToTextOptions Instanz konfiguriert, die vom Rest der Pipeline verwendet wird. |
| GetTextAsync(Stream, SpeechToTextOptions, CancellationToken) |
Stellt einen delegierenden Chatclient dar, der eine SpeechToTextOptions Instanz konfiguriert, die vom Rest der Pipeline verwendet wird. |
Erweiterungsmethoden
| Name | Beschreibung |
|---|---|
| AsBuilder(ISpeechToTextClient) |
Erstellt eine neue SpeechToTextClientBuilder Verwendung |
| GetService<TService>(ISpeechToTextClient, Object) |
Fragt nach ISpeechToTextClient einem Objekt vom Typ |
| GetStreamingTextAsync(ISpeechToTextClient, DataContent, SpeechToTextOptions, CancellationToken) |
Generiert Text aus Sprache, die eine einzelne Audiosprache DataContentbereitstellt. |
| GetTextAsync(ISpeechToTextClient, DataContent, SpeechToTextOptions, CancellationToken) |
Generiert Text aus Sprache, die eine einzelne Audiosprache DataContentbereitstellt. |